What is Custom Package Printing?

Custom package printing refers to the process of crafting completely unique packaging, bespoke for your brand. Every aspect including art, layout, dimensions, structure, and finishing details can be adjusted according to your exact requirements. Your custom package printer will work with you, step by step, to create a one-of-a-kind design that maximizes presentation, without sacrificing on protection for the contents within.

1. Structural Innovation

The most basic packaging structures are simple boxes. They’re straightforward, accommodate a wide variety of products, and generally get the job done. However, on their own, these structures don’t do much to move the needle on either protection or presentation. That’s where structural innovation comes in handy. 

Packaging designers can turn rudimentary packaging into efficiency-improving, eye-catching, brand-building enclosures with enhanced protective features in a number of ways, including:

  • Collapsible Designs – Collapsible packaging is designed for easy flat-shipping or storage. The pieces can then be quickly assembled as needed.
  • Multi-functional Designs – Multifunctional packaging provides added value to the consumer through features like re-usability, long-term storage, and product display.
  • Interactive Elements – Interactive packaging incorporates features like QR codes, games, and even crafts to encourage elevated brand engagement.

3. Personalization and Customization

Personalization takes many forms in custom package printing and designing. Perhaps the most prominent is printed artwork, which can be displayed across every surface of the packaging, inside and out. However, these two dimensional design elements are only the start.

The overall shape of the packaging can also be robustly customized. Dimensions can be adjusted to ensure a perfect fit for the products inside, while details like product windows can be shaped to reflect your brand and display products to their best advantage.

A third opportunity for customization comes with inserts and dividers. These components can help organize the space within a larger package and protect products during transit.

4. Creative Coatings and Design Elements

Finally, the fine details can’t be overlooked. Take the layout of the artwork, for example. Its placement and positioning on the packaging must be carefully considered. Done too hastily, the final product is likely to suffer from poor alignment of the design elements, inconsistent branding, and a general sloppy impression.

Other fine details to consider are coatings and finishes. Different coatings impart different qualities to the packaging, elevating its perceived value. For example:

  • Cold Foil can be used to create bright metallic images and text.
  • Glossy Coating can be applied to add clear shine to all or part of the packaging.
  • PMS Inks can be used for ultra-precise color matching on packaging elements.
  • Soft Touch imparts a velvety texture that enhances the tactility of the printing.

The process of designing and printing custom packaging tends to follow four basic steps:

First, the client will sit down with their packaging expert to discuss the specifications of the packaging. This includes the required dimensions, what materials the packaging will be made of, and how the client envisions it opening, hanging, being displayed, etc.

Second, the packaging professionals will map out the most efficient production process possible. The goal is to limit or eliminate hand assembly entirely hand, to boost production times and lower production costs.

The third step is to build a mockup of the packaging. Once created, all parties will review the design and determine what adjustments need to be made to the shape, print design, construction, etc.

Lastly, embellishments like cold foil and soft touch can be selected to enhance the finalized design. The packaging creator will work with the client to determine where and how these embellishments will be placed in relation to the approved artwork.
